Prime Life are on the lookout for passionate and dedicated care professionals to join our friendly team as a Support Worker, on a bank basis. At present, we have several vacancies available and are keen to meet with candidates as soon as possible for interviews.

This role will be based at The Fieldings Residential Home in the heart of Sutton in Ashfield, Nottinghamshire. The home has been specially designed to cater to the every need of 47 residents, living with a range of physical disabilities and mental health conditions that require dignified support from our caring team. It is essential that candidates for this role are therefore patient, understanding and respectful of our residents’ individual abilities.

Benefits of becoming our Bank Support Worker:

This role offers great work-life balance, with regular set shift patterns between the hours of 8am and 8pm, across a 7-day working week. In return for your commitment to our residents, we can offer a range of excellent benefits including:

  1. Hourly rates of pay ranging from £12.45 to £12.80 per hour dependent upon qualification level
  2. Opportunities to learn and progress with the support of our dedicated Quality Matters team
  3. Fully funded DBS
  4. Comprehensive Holiday Pay scheme that rewards you for your commitment to care
  5. Fantastic Refer a Friend scheme, offering up to £250 per successful candidate!

Responsibilities of our Bank Support Worker include:

  1. Providing respectful and dignified support to residents
  2. Encouraging residents to achieve the highest possible quality of life that is right for them
  3. Providing companionship whilst giving emotional and practical support
  4. Assisting residents to participate in any decisions relating to their daily living arrangements
  5. Helping residents with day-to-day activities such as assisting with personal care, recreational activities, accompanying residents outside of the home, etc.
  6. Promoting resident independence in the preparation of food and/or at mealtimes
  7. Working with other professionals to provide individualized care and development plans

What we’re looking for in our Bank Support Worker:

To be successful within this role, you will have a genuine caring nature and a desire to make a real difference for our residents. Though prior experience as a Support Worker or Care Assistant is desirable, this is not essential as full training is provided. Typically, our residents live with mental health conditions, learning disabilities, and physical disabilities that require dignified support from our care team. It is essential that candidates for this role are therefore patient, understanding, and respectful of our residents’ individual abilities.
